Off-site run checklist, item 4: Velden Labs prototype shipment. The two Corvid-series controller boards and the sensor rig are packed in the grey anti-static case, foam inserts checked and latches sealed. Calibration sheets are in the document sleeve on the lid. The case must stay upright and out of direct heat during transit to the Ostley test facility. Receiving should verify the seals on arrival before signing. The courier hand-over instruction for this consignment is given on the line below.

handover note for yagef-bagep: the drudor pelius courier leaves the kasdor zorvan norir ledger at gate 8016 under passcode 755406

Handover Note — Regional Sales Review

From: M. Tarrenhall, Director of Sales
To: E. Voss, Incoming Director

For branch managers: the review of the Westreach and Calderin regions is complete. Westreach finished 3% above plan, carried largely by the Penmore branch; Calderin missed target, mainly on renewal slippage. Corrective actions are documented per branch, with owners and dates. Please read your branch section carefully before the follow-up calls next week. The broader direction informing these actions is summarised in the note below.

board note of kageg-bahof: The renewal with Holwynax Holdings closes at $2 million a year, 5 percent below the last contract. Project Ulaath slips by two quarters because of the supplier delay.

**Quarterly Planning Note — Pricing, Merrowline Product Range**

For the finance team. We propose holding the Merrowline core SKUs at current list price while raising the premium variants by 6%, phased over two quarters. Input costs from the Veldt contract justify the increase, and elasticity modelling suggests minimal volume loss. Channel partners will receive sixty days' notice. Discounting authority tightens to regional leads only. The pricing stance reflects a wider commercial intention, recorded below.

internal memo for kagap-hahig: Project Aldeth slips by six weeks because of the staffing delay.

### Step 3: Warm the Tax-Rate Cache

Quick one — after upgrading Tallyfox, the tax-rate lookup cache starts cold, so the first batch of quotes will hit the rates service directly and feel slow. Totally expected; don't escalate it. Run the warmer job once and it settles in a few minutes. Before kicking it off, make sure the cache node is running with these values.

config for tagep-yajef:
ulawyn:
  log_level: error
  metrics_host: metrics.ulawyn.lumiclabs.internal
  pin: 0564
  pool_size: 32